Congratulations to managing partner Jeffrey Kimmel for being inducted into the Plainview-Old Bethpage/JFK High School Athletic Hall of Fame. Jeff was recognized for his superior athletics in four varsity sports: soccer, basketball, baseball, and football.  He was a 4-year member of the school’s Varsity Soccer program.  He was the first freshman ever to play varsity.  During his career, he scored 60 goals and led Kennedy High School to the class “B” New York State Championship; still, the only team to win a State Championship in school history.  As a senior, he led Nassau County with 32 goals and was named All-County.  As a junior, he scored 17 goals and was named All-Conference.  He was also a 3-year member of the Varsity Football program and still holds the school record with a 43-yard field goal.  He was a 3-year Varsity Baseball player, serving as team captain in his senior year when he earned All-Conference honors.  He was also a 3-year Varsity member of the Kennedy Basketball team.

After High School, Jeff attended the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ania, where he played Varsity Soccer for the Quakers and majored in Entrepreneurial Management and Marketing.
